Dubki (Samara region)

Dubki is a village in the Krasnoyarsk district of the Samara region . Included in the urban settlement Novosemeykino.

History

In 1973, by a decree of the Presidium of the Armed Forces of the RSFSR, the village of the auxiliary farm of the hospital was renamed Dubki [2] .
